In an endearingly serene Cotswold hamlet not far from Malmesbury, the Rectory Hotel is a picture of English charm surrounded by three acres of formal walled gardens complete with a sunken Victorian pool. There are views of the village church – and everything else besides – from most tables in the beamed and wood-panelled restaurant.
The menu proudly proclaims its 'British' loyalties, adding that 'the majority of the produce with the exception of fish is sourced within 30 miles of the hotel'.
